Transaction 343844e65fd158b21eae8fc309051bae64b703d1eb7692fc7e85793469200055
1 Input
1 Output
-
343844e65fd158b21eae8fc309051bae64b703d1eb7692fc7e85793469200055: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d0859bea3f1dae602abe85f7e00bb9b3506b4cfe8842f5fc237819f5fab6febd
- address
- bc1p6zzeh63lrkhxq247shm7qzaekdgxkn873pp0tlpr0qvlt74kl67s5pf3yc